What works.
- Put the shortest question first to hook attention.
- Use clear and concise language throughout the form.
- Ensure all required fields are clearly marked.
- Provide helpful instructions or tooltips for complex questions.
- Regularly review and update the form to reflect current institutional needs.
- Test the form thoroughly before going live to catch any potential issues.
- Offer multiple ways to submit the form, such as online or via email.
- Keep the design simple and uncluttered to avoid overwhelming applicants.
- Automate notifications to keep applicants informed of their application status.
- Ensure compliance with data protection regulations when handling applicant information.

Common mistakes.
- Asking for too much information upfront, which may discourage applicants.
- Not clearly marking required fields, leading to incomplete submissions.
- Failing to test the form for usability and functionality before deployment.
- Neglecting to update the form regularly to reflect changing institutional requirements.
- Not providing clear instructions or support for applicants who have questions.
